Rixindao

Rixindao is a small island located in the middle of a reservoir. The island is accessible via two suspension bridges and is home to many peacocks and other farm animals. Visitors can enjoy the peaceful surroundings and visit the on-site cafe. ^3

Luzhunan Historical House

The Luzhunan Historical House is a small village that has been preserved to showcase traditional life in Taiwan. The village houses offer exhibits on traditional pottery, rice milling displays, and noodle shops. Visitors can learn about the culture and history of Taiwan and enjoy the rustic charm of the village. ^9

Shitan Old Street

Shitan Old Street is a charming old street in Touwu that showcases traditional Hakka culture. The street features traditional wood-framed Hakka facades and is lined with tea and craft shops. Visitors can enjoy the retro atmosphere and admire the many cartoon murals that decorate the street. ^11
